1. Cuyahoga County Board of Developmental Disabilities Presentation
2. Approval of the minutes of the regular meeting of December 15, 2025 (attached herewith).
3. Amending or renumbering multiple sections of Chapters 1211, 1213, 1216, 1220, 1221, 1222, 1223, 1224, 1225, 1230, 1231, 1232, 1233, 1234, 1240, 1241, 1250, 1251, 1252, 1253, 1260, 1262, and 1263; adding new Chapters 1235 (Sections .01-.11) and 1236 (Sections .01-.11); adding new Sections 1253.06, 1262.10, 1263.24, and 1263.26; and deleting Sections 1253.07, 1262.18, and 1263.01, of Part Twelve, Zoning Code, of the Codified Ordinances of the City of Shaker Heights to amend the zoning map and text to rezone the commercial areas along Lee Road and Larchmere Boulevard and update the Zoning Code. (CPC)
4. Authorizing the donation of two used rescue squads from the Shaker Heights Fire Department to the City of Maple Heights and the Village of Oakwood, and declaring an emergency. (SPW), (FIN)
5. Authorizing a second amendment to the contract with Suburban Maintenance & Construction, Inc. to increase the total compensation by $50,000 for ongoing fencing rental at the nuisance property known as the Lee-Scottsdale Building, at 3756 Lee Road, and declaring an emergency. (FIN)
6. Authorizing the purchase of backflow prevention valves repair services and replacement valves from Brakefire Inc. dba Silco Fire and Security at a cost of $62,188, and waiving public bidding, and declaring an emergency. (SPW), (FIN)
7. Accepting a proposal and authorizing a personal, professional consultant contract with Partners Environmental, Safety and Engineering, in the total not to exceed amount of $45,250, for the City Safety Assessment Project, and declaring an emergency. (SPW), (FIN)
8. Authorizing a personal services contract with Chagrin Valley Dispatch to provide employment services for the Crisis Assistance and Local Linkage (CALL) Program in the cities of Shaker Heights, Cleveland Heights, University Heights, Richmond Heights and South Euclid for a period of one year, and declaring an emergency. (SPW), (FIN)
Items 9 & 10
11. Authorizing the execution of Then and Now Certificates by the Director of Finance and the payment of amounts due for various purchase orders, and declaring an emergency. (FIN)
